   PRESIDENT OF THE ITALIAN REPUBLIC GUEST OF THE POPE   
   Vatican City, 12 2012 (VIS) - Yesterday afternoon the Holy Father welcomed   
   Giorgio Napolitano, president of the Republic of Italy, and his wife, Clio   
   Maria Bittoni to the papal summer residence in Castel Gandolfo. They met   
   briefly in the Apostolic   
   Palace's Garden of the Moor, later conversing along the parapets of the   
   gardens.   
   At 6:00pm the president and the Holy Father attended a concert of the   
   West-Eastern Divan Orchestra, directed by Maestro Daniel Barenboim, whom they   
   greeted after the performance. Afterwards the president of the Republic and   
   his wife dined with the Pope   
   in his private apartments.

   UNIVERSAL LANGUAGE OF MUSIC, HOPE FOR PEACE   
   Vatican City, 12 July 2012 (VIS) - "It pleases me to welcome an orchestra such   
   as this one, which was born of the conviction, or better yet, of the   
   experience that music unites persons, over and above any division". With these   
   words the Pope thanked   
   Director Daniel Barenboim and the musicians of the West-Eastern Divan   
   Orchestra for the concert given in the Apostolic Palace of Castelgandolfo to   
   celebrate the feast of St. Benedict, patron of Europe.   
   "Music", the pontiff continued, "is the harmony of differences ... from the   
   multiplicity of tones of the various instruments a symphony can arise.   
   However, this doesn't happen magically or automatically. It comes only from   
   ... a patient and laborious   
   commitment, which requires time and sacrifices in the effort to listen to one   
   another, avoiding excessive egoism and privileging the best success of the   
   whole".   
   "In these moments I am thinking of the great symphony of peace between the   
   peoples that is never complete. My generation, like that of Director   
   Barenboim's parents', lived the tragedy of the Second World war and the Shoah.   
   It is highly meaningful that   
   the maestro desired to bring a to life a project like the West-Eastern Divan   
   Orchestra: a group in which musicians from Israel, Palestine, and other Arabic   
   nations play; Jewish, Muslim, and Christian persons. The numerous   
   acknowledgements that have been   
   conferred on you and this orchestra demonstrate your professional excellence   
   as well as your ethical and spiritual commitment".   
   Continuing, the Pope emphasized that the symphonies that were performed,   
   Beethoven's Fifth and Sixth, express two aspects of life: "drama and peace;   
   humanity's struggle against adversity and its enlightening immersion in a   
   bucolic environment... The   
   message I would like to draw from it for today is this: to achieve peace we   
   must dedicate ourselves to dialogue with a personal and communal conversion,   
   patiently seeking possible areas of understanding".   
   "I wish and pray that each of you", he concluded, "continue sowing the hope   
   for peace in the world through the universal language of music".

   SPOKESPERSONS OF EUROPEAN EPISCOPAL CONFERENCES MEET IN COLOGNE   
   Vatican City, 12 July 2012 (VIS) - Members of the press and spokespersons of   
   the European Episcopal conferences met in Cologne, Germany to discuss the   
   relationship between the media and the Catholic Church.   
   Bishops, priests, and laypersons from across the continent are participating   
   in the various sessions of the meeting, which will take place from 11 to 14   
   July. It will deal with, among other themes, communication regarding financial   
   issues related to the   
   life of the churches. A special session will be held dedicated to the Year of   
   Faith and the media projects of the various episcopal conferences related to   
   this event.
